shuber 2005/02/14 15:40:25 CET
Modified files:
core/src/java/org/jahia/services/webdav/listeners
CMSSlideContentListener.java
Log:
Added check for start page existence.
Revision Changes Path
1.5 +7 -3
jahia/core/src/java/org/jahia/services/webdav/listeners/CMSSlideContentListener.java
http://jahia.mine.nu:8080/cgi-bin/cvsweb.cgi/jahia/core/src/java/org/jahia/services/webdav/listeners/CMSSlideContentListener.java.diff?r1=1.4&r2=1.5&f=h
Index: CMSSlideContentListener.java
===================================================================
RCS file:
/home/cvs/repository/jahia/core/src/java/org/jahia/services/webdav/listeners/CMSSlideContentListener.java,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- CMSSlideContentListener.java 14 Feb 2005 11:59:44 -0000 1.4
+++ CMSSlideContentListener.java 14 Feb 2005 14:40:25 -0000 1.5
@@ -49,10 +49,10 @@
* Time: 15:23:17
* <p/>
* $Author: shuber $
- * $Date: 2005/02/14 11:59:44 $
- * $Id: CMSSlideContentListener.java,v 1.4 2005/02/14 11:59:44 shuber Exp $
+ * $Date: 2005/02/14 14:40:25 $
+ * $Id: CMSSlideContentListener.java,v 1.5 2005/02/14 14:40:25 shuber Exp $
* $RCSfile: CMSSlideContentListener.java,v $
- * $Revision: 1.4 $
+ * $Revision: 1.5 $
* $Source:
/home/cvs/repository/jahia/core/src/java/org/jahia/services/webdav/listeners/CMSSlideContentListener.java,v
$
* $State: Exp $
*/
@@ -169,6 +169,10 @@
getJahiaPageService();
JahiaPage curPage = pageService.lookupPage(pageId, jParams);
+ if (curPage == null) {
+ logger.warn("Couldn't find start page "+pageId+" for hierarchy");
+ return null;
+ }
jParams.setPage(curPage);
if (relativeFileName.startsWith("/")) {